4. Public minting, wallets, and gas fees

Mint only when you are ready to make the memory permanent and public.

Minting requires the memory, media, story, and saved location to be public. The NFT image and metadata may include an image, story excerpt, date, time, location label, exact latitude and longitude, internal memory identifier, and public wallet address.

When you confirm minting, you instruct BWK and its providers to upload NFT material to IPFS and request a transaction through your wallet on the displayed blockchain network. Blockchain transactions are normally irreversible. Published information may remain available indefinitely and may be copied or indexed by anyone.

BWK does not currently charge you a platform or service fee. Your wallet may require you to pay a blockchain gas fee to process your mint. The gas fee is a network cost paid through your wallet for your transaction. It is not paid to BWK. Gas fees can change and may be charged even if a transaction is delayed or fails, depending on the network and wallet.

You are responsible for checking the network, wallet, transaction details, public content, and estimated gas fee before approval. BWK does not control wallets, public blockchains, gas prices, IPFS availability, RPC providers, or block explorers. We do not promise that an NFT will have financial value, remain accessible through every gateway, or be compatible with every marketplace or wallet. BWK is not an investment, exchange, custody, or financial-advice service.
